SQLServer2000数据库创建与管理实践
版权申诉
172 浏览量
更新于2024-07-02
收藏 821KB PDF 举报
"实验1+数据库的创建与管理.pdf"
实验1主要关注数据库的创建、管理和维护,旨在强化对数据库基础知识的理解,并通过实践操作掌握创建数据库的技巧。实验的目标包括:
1. 巩固数据库理论知识,理解数据库在实际应用中的重要性。
2. 学习并熟练使用两种创建数据库的方法,确保对数据库创建过程有全面了解。
3. 掌握查看、修改数据库属性的技能,以便于管理和优化数据库性能。
4. 学会如何缩小数据库大小、重命名以及安全地删除数据库,确保数据库系统的灵活性和稳定性。
背景知识中提到了SQL Server 2000数据库系统,其中包含的主要数据文件、次要数据文件和事务日志文件:
- 主要数据文件(.MDF):存储数据库的启动信息和数据,包括用户对象(如表、存储过程、视图)和系统对象。系统表应保留在主要数据文件中,但用户信息可移动到次要数据文件。
- 次要数据文件(.NDF):用于扩展数据库存储空间,可存放用户数据。根据需要,可以有多个次要数据文件,以分摊存储负担,提升并发性能。
- 事务日志文件(.LDF):记录数据库的事务历史,用于备份和恢复。每个数据库至少需要一个事务日志文件,以确保事务处理的完整性和一致性。
创建数据库的方式主要有两种:
- 企业管理器:图形化界面,直观易用,适合初学者和日常管理。
- Transact-SQL:SQL Server 2000的核心语言,提供更强大的编程能力,适用于复杂任务和自动化操作。Transact-SQL扩展了标准SQL,支持程序流程控制、局部变量等功能,可用于构建数据库对象和执行复杂的查询。
通过这个实验,学习者将深入理解数据库的工作原理,掌握数据库管理系统的基本操作,为后续的数据库设计、开发和管理奠定坚实基础。在实践中,不仅能够增强理论知识,还能提高实际操作技能,为未来在互联网领域的数据库应用做好准备。
2020-06-10 上传
2021-09-21 上传
2022-06-25 上传
2021-10-20 上传
2021-10-22 上传
2021-10-04 上传
2022-06-28 上传
2022-07-13 上传
2021-10-11 上传
春哥111
- 粉丝: 1w+
- 资源: 5万+
最新资源
- Angular实现MarcHayek简历展示应用教程
- Crossbow Spot最新更新 - 获取Chrome扩展新闻
- 量子管道网络优化与Python实现
- Debian系统中APT缓存维护工具的使用方法与实践
- Python模块AccessControl的Windows64位安装文件介绍
- 掌握最新*** Fisher资讯,使用Google Chrome扩展
- Ember应用程序开发流程与环境配置指南
- EZPCOpenSDK_v5.1.2_build***版本更新详情
- Postcode-Finder:利用JavaScript和Google Geocode API实现
- AWS商业交易监控器:航线行为分析与营销策略制定
- AccessControl-4.0b6压缩包详细使用教程
- Python编程实践与技巧汇总
- 使用Sikuli和Python打造颜色求解器项目
- .Net基础视频教程:掌握GDI绘图技术
- 深入理解数据结构与JavaScript实践项目
- 双子座在线裁判系统:提高编程竞赛效率